Plain-English summary
CVE-2022-21566 affects Oracle Applications Framework in Oracle E-Business Suite. An unauthenticated attacker with HTTP network access could gain unauthorized access to critical Oracle Applications Framework data. The issue is confidentiality-focused, not described as changing data or causing outage.
Executive priority
Treat this as a high-priority data exposure issue for affected Oracle E-Business Suite environments, especially where HTTP access is not tightly restricted. Prioritize confirmation of affected versions and vendor remediation status.
Technical view
Oracle describes an easily exploitable Diagnostics component vulnerability in Oracle Applications Framework versions 12.2.9 through 12.2.11. CVSS 3.1 is 7.5: network attack vector, low complexity, no privileges, no user interaction, unchanged scope, high confidentiality impact, no integrity or availability impact.
Likely exposure
Exposure is most likely in organizations running Oracle E-Business Suite with Oracle Applications Framework 12.2.9, 12.2.10, or 12.2.11 reachable over HTTP.
Exploitation context
The supplied sources do not show CISA KEV listing or active exploitation evidence. The risk remains significant because Oracle describes unauthenticated, low-complexity remote access over HTTP with potential access to critical data.

Mitigation direction
- Review Oracle's July 2022 Critical Patch Update guidance for CVE-2022-21566.
- Apply the relevant Oracle-supported update or remediation for affected E-Business Suite systems.
- Restrict HTTP access to Oracle E-Business Suite to trusted networks where feasible.
- Prioritize internet-facing or broadly reachable Oracle Applications Framework deployments first.
Validation and detection
- Inventory Oracle E-Business Suite deployments and confirm Applications Framework versions.
- Check whether versions 12.2.9 through 12.2.11 are present.
- Confirm the July 2022 Oracle CPU or later applicable guidance is applied.
- Identify whether Oracle Applications Framework is reachable over HTTP from untrusted networks.
- Review access logs for unusual unauthenticated Diagnostics-related activity.
